2009 Professional Gemmologist Decals

The 2009 version of the point-of-sale Professional Gemmologist decals have been mailed along with the Spring edition of The Canadian Gemmologist. This year we have both English and French versions of the decals.

The static cling decals can be applied to any glass surface. The decal must first be removed from its paper backing and is applied by firmly pressing the image side to the inside of a glass door or the inside of a glass display case. The decal will stick best if firm pressure is applied to the entire backside surface of the decal - this can be done with your fingers or by using a straight edge or  ruler.

Coloured Gemstone Grading and Valuation - July 10 to 12, 2009

Register now for the next session of Coloured Gemstone Grading and Valuation. 

 

This advanced three-day workshop will benefit gem trade professionals, gemmology students and enthusiasts alike.

 

Students will learn the skills to accurately grade and value coloured gemstones. Emphasis on hands-on practice with a variety of gems of different quality will provide students with the knowledge to become confident buyers and sellers in the rapidly growing coloured stone market.
